Vektoriesitys
Vektoriesitys is a method of visualizing data using vectors, which are mathematical entities that have both magnitude and direction. This technique is particularly useful in fields such as physics, engineering, and computer science, where understanding the direction and strength of forces, velocities, or other quantities is crucial. In vektoriesitys, each data point is represented as a vector in a multi-dimensional space, with the length of the vector corresponding to the magnitude of the data and the direction indicating the category or attribute.
